Dag Hammarskjöld

Dag Hammarskjöld was born in 1905. He famously served as Secretary General of the United Nations from 1953 until his death in 1961. He was also a member of the Swedish Academy from 1954. Cecilia Hansson

Cecilia Hansson (b. 1973), was born in Luleå and now lives in Stockholm. She is an author, poet and journalist, and regularly contribute in the Swedish daily Svenska Dagbladet. She is a board member of Swedish PEN and a well-known expert on Central Europe.

Viktoria Jäderling

Viktoria Jäderling (b. 1971) in Sundsvall is a literary critic and journal editor. Her first book Oh, Lunargatan was nominated to Borås Debutantpris and Katapultpriset. Today she lives in Stockholm.

Anna Larsson

Anna Larsson (b. 1971) has a master’s degree in economics and runs her own consultancy business. Her debut, Rumour Has It, came in 2021, a passionate and entertaining novel set partly in the Swedish publishing world and partly in Hollywood. It sold over 20,000 copies and sold to four countries. Åsa Leijon

Åsa Leijon (b. 1968) lives in Uppsala where she works as a high school teacher. DROWNING IN SILENCE is her debut novel.

Jens Liljestrand

Jens Liljestrand (b. 1974) is a literary scholar, critic and author. He is half Danish and spent his childhood summers at Bornholm. His previous novel Even If Everything Ends, published in 2021, became a huge international bestseller and sold to over 20 countries.

Jennie Lundgren

Jennie Lundgren (b. 1978) and Ulrika Lundgren Lindmark (b. 1972) are sisters-in-law living in Kalix and Gällivare, northern Sweden, respectively. Jennie works as a police patrol officer and Ulrika is an accountant. WHERE THE ICE BREAKS is a debut for both writers.
